    Where Does The Name "Siegel" Come From? What About "Segan?" (Hebrew)

    I heard Siegel comes from Segan in Hebrew, is this true and if so, what does Segun mean in Hebrew?

    Top Place of origin for Siegel and Segan is Germany.
    Siegel comes from Segal which is an acronym from the Hebrew phrase SeGan
    Levia ‘assistant Levite’.
    Segun and Segan is an habitational name from Sagan meaning Kettle.
